Summary
EBAA IRON, INC has accumulated 29 OSHA violations across 8 inspections over 43 years of recorded history, with $4,863 in total assessed penalties.
The establishment sits in the 80th perc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 76 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 83rd perc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 4 years ago.

Inspection history
| Date | Trigger | Violations | Serious | Penalty |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2022-05-24 | Complaint | 3 | — | $2,199 | |
| 1996-08-12 | Planned | 1 | — | $844 | |
| 1993-03-23 | Planned | 0 | — | $0 | |
| 1991-02-26 | Referral | 3 | — | $300 | |
| 1989-08-01 | Planned | 22 | 17 | $1,520 | |
| 1987-04-09 | Planned | 0 | — | $0 | |
| 1985-06-13 | Planned | 0 | — | $0 | |
| 1983-06-10 | Planned | 0 | — | $0 |
Source: OSHA IMIS. Citation amounts reflect initially assessed penalties; final amounts after appeal may differ.
